📍 Where it landed
Hamas dissolved its government in Gaza to transfer power to technocrats and a UN-backed committee. Israel warned the move was a trick to prevent disarmament and maintain Hezbollah-style control.

The brief
Hamas plans to announce the dissolution of its governing administration in Gaza. The move involves the resignation of the governing body to facilitate a transition of power.
Coverage from Haaretz, The Times of Israel, Ynetnews, i24NEWS, and The Jerusalem Post emphasizes the handover of authority to Palestinian technocrats. The Jerusalem Post reports that a Hamas official has already resigned as the process begins.
Future developments depend on the official announcement of the dissolution and the subsequent installation of the technocratic panel.
